“The Cross is the preserver of the whole universe, the Cross is the beauty of the Church,.. the Cross is the glory of angels and the scourge of demons.” This is how the Holy Church glorifies the Life-giving Cross of the Lord.

The Cross is given to every Christian as early as in infancy at Holy Baptism. The Cross accompanies us throughout our lives. And, finally, the Cross adorns the man’s last place of respite, the burial mound. Great is the power of the Life-giving Cross and we are called to treat the memory of the Cross with particular reverence. Each year, the Holy Cross is elevated on this day for the faithful to worship it, so that the tree of the Lord’s Cross blesses our earthly journey and gives us strength to fight sin.

The rite of the elevation of the Holy Cross was performed during the All-Night Vigil in the Trinity Cathedral of the Seraphim-Diveyevo monastery. Rev. Fr. Vladimir Kargin, the monastery’s senior priest, presided at the service.

The Cross is repeatedly raised five times in the middle of the temple: to the east, west, south, north and again to the east. Each time, the clergy pour fragrant water on the Cross, as a symbol of the grace of the Holy Spirit. Each time, the people are called to pray: for the Holy Patriarch and the ruling bishop, our country, its authorities and the army, for every Christian soul and all those who serve in this holy church.

The choir sings, “Lord, have mercy!” one hundred times. During the singing of the first fifty refrains, the celebrating priest slowly lowers the Cross reaching as low as he can. As the Cross is lowered, the voices of the singers grow from quiet to silent. During the second half of the ceremony, the priest gradually raises the Cross. Likewise, the volume of singing voices rises, going to higher notes, intensifying and ending with a threefold solemn “Lord, have mercy!” At the end of the singing, the celebrating priest blesses everyone with the cross three times.

At the end of the ceremony, the Cross was laid on the analogion in the center of the church and those who prayed there came to venerate it and receive the anointing with holy oil.
